Fox Factory Holding Corp. (NASDAQ:FOXF – Free Report) – Stock analysts at Roth Capital increased their Q3 2025 earnings per share (EPS) estimates for shares of Fox Factory in a research report issued to clients and investors on Friday, May 3rd. Roth Capital analyst S. Stember now forecasts that the company will earn $1.22 per share for the quarter, up from their previous forecast of $1.15. The consensus estimate for Fox Factory’s current full-year earnings is $2.42 per share. Roth Capital also issued estimates for Fox Factory’s Q4 2025 earnings at $1.17 EPS.
Fox Factory (NASDAQ:FOXF – Get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Thursday, May 2nd. The company reported $0.29 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.19 by $0.10. The firm had revenue of $333.50 million for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$327.58 million. Fox Factory had a net margin of 5.41% and a return on equity of 10.50%. The business’s revenue was down 16.6%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ter last year, the business earned $1.20 earnings per share.

Fox Factory Stock Performance
Fox Factory stock opened at $43.52 on Monday. The firm has a 50-day moving average of $46.45 and a 200-day moving average of $59.31. The firm has a market cap of $1.83 billion, a P/E ratio of 24.31, a P/E/G ratio of 3.66 and a beta of 1.68. The company has a current ratio of 3.70, a quick ratio of 1.91 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.61. Fox Factory has a 1-year low of $37.98 and a 1-year high of $117.68.

About Fox Factory
Fox Factory Holding Corp. designs, engineers, manufactures, and markets performance-defining products and system worldwide. The company offers powered vehicle products for side-by-side vehicles, on-road vehicles with and without off-road capabilities, off-road vehicles and trucks, all-terrain vehicles, snowmobiles, and specialty vehicles and applications, such as military, motorcycles, and commercial trucks; lift kits and components with shock products and aftermarket accessory packages for trucks; and mid-end and high-end front fork and rear suspension products.
